Final Fantasy 14 7.51 New Ultimate Raid
Final Fantasy XIV 7.51 introduced a brand-new Ultimate raid intended for a team of eight players. This is an ultimate challenge for players who have some experience in Savage and want to face an even more difficult level of combat. As any Ultimate requires thorough preparation, this article will provide only basic information.
Key FFXIV 7.51 Raid details:
- The new Ultimate raid is a level 100 duty.
- It requires a full party of 8 players.
- The duty has a 120-minute time limit.
- Players must complete AAC Heavyweight M4 (Savage) first.
- The unlock NPC is the Wandering Minstrel in Tuliyollal (X:11.1 Y:14.6).
- Entry is available through Raid Finder after forming a full eligible party.
- The weekly reward can be exchanged with Uah’shepya in Solution Nine (X:8.7 Y:13.5).
- Rewards include Palazzo Diamond weapons.

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Auxesia Unlock Requirements
To unlock Auxesia in Final Fantasy 14 7.51, you need to start the quest The Forests of Paradise. This quest opens access to the new Cosmic Exploration destination added in Patch 7.51.
FFXIV 7.51 Auxesia Requirements:
- Reach level 10 with any Disciple of the Hand or Land.
- Complete the quest Memory’s Orbit.
- Speak with Searchingway in Oizys (X:17.2 Y:22.8).
- Start the quest The Forests of Paradise.
- Use your Home World, since Cosmic Exploration quests can only be accessed and progressed there.
After unlocking FF14 Auxesia, you can travel there through the Bestways Burrow aetheryte. Speak to Drivingway in Mare Lamentorum (X:21.9 Y:13.2). You can also reach Auxesia through Cruisingway from previous Cosmic Exploration destinations.
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Auxesia Currency
There are the Auxesia progression Credits and Exploration Tokens that you can farm during your explorations in FF14 7.51. Auxesia Credits are obtained from stellar missions and mecha operations ground support from Auxesia. These credits are used by players to apply for mecha operation from the star or purchase cosmic fortunes using them.
Another currency, Auxesia Exploration Tokens have a different purpose, which is mostly that of rewarding players. These tokens are obtained through EX+ stellar missions and Tool Mastery Missions. The tokens may be redeemed for a unique mount. Both the tokens and the mount are saleable on the market board.
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Starward Standings
FFXIV Starward Standing is also affected during Auxesia. In patch 7.51, Standings are determined depending on players’ contributions to stellar missions, Tool Mastery Missions, mech operations, and projects that are done on Auxesia. Contributions towards your standing from other Cosmic Exploration locations are not counted.
Players can find out what their standings are by talking to Scanningway in Auxesia (X:26.8 Y:28.7). Star Contributor players will get an award for the same, in which players will have a hologram, a name on the standing monument, and visual effects on the CE.
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Tool Mastery Missions
Score-Based Tool Mastery Challenges are the latest additions to the Cosmic Exploration game missions in Final Fantasy 14 Patch 7.51. They are accessible on Auxesia by those who have finished the last step of their cosmic tool. In place of completing a mission, you aim to score the most points during the given period.
Key FFXIV 7.51 Tool Mastery Missions details:
- Tool Mastery Missions are tied to Auxesia.
- You need a completed final-stage cosmic tool to access them.
- Each class has three Tool Mastery Missions.
- The game records your high score for each completed mission.
- Rewards include tool mastery points, cosmic class score, Starward Standings contribution, cosmic credits, Auxesia credits, and Auxesia exploration tokens.
- Higher scores improve your rewards and contribution.
- Score objectives can grant bonuses like extra time, higher score multipliers, extra duty action uses, and GP recovery.
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Cosmic Tools Enhancements
Final Fantasy 14 Patch 7.51 also expands Cosmic Tools progression. Now, you can enhance these tools further by earning research data through stellar missions. The good news is that your cosmic tool does not need to be equipped to gain research data, which makes progression less awkward while playing different classes.
You can check the required research through Cosmic Research on the exotablet. Once you have enough data, report to Researchingway on your current star to obtain enhanced prototypes and cosmic tools.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Tiisol Ja Unlock Requirements
To unlock Tiisol Ja Custom Deliveries in FFXIV 7.51, start the quest Taco Time. You need a Disciple of the Hand or Land at level 90 and then speak with Hhuki in Tuliyollal (X:13.7 Y:12.1).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Tiisol Ja Rewards
FFXIV Tiisol Ja Custom Deliveries reward gil, experience points, crafters’ scrips, or gatherers’ scrips. Players can complete a total of 12 Custom Deliveries per week, so Tiisol Ja competes with other Custom Delivery clients for your weekly allowance.
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Dye and Pigment Changes
Final Fantasy XIV Patch 7.51 changes how several dye-related materials work. Blue Pigment, Red Pigment, Yellow Pigment, Grey Pigment, Brown Pigment, Green Pigment, and Purple Pigment have been consolidated into an all-purpose pigment. Players who still have old colored pigments can exchange them through Calamity Salvagers in Limsa Lominsa, Gridania, and Ul’dah.
| Before Final Fantasy 14 7.51 | After Final Fantasy 14 7.51 |
|---|---|
| Multiple colored pigment items | One all-purpose pigment |
| Colored pigments from gathering points | All-purpose pigment from gathering points |
| Colored pigment market listings | Colored pigments removed from the market search and trade |
| Old retainer pigment ventures | New all-purpose pigment ventures |
| Standard spectrum dye used older pigment logic | New recipe uses all-purpose pigment |
Final Fantasy 14 7.51 Housing and System Updates
Final Fantasy 14 Patch 7.51 also includes several housing and system updates:
- The feature that hides furnishings when more than 400 furnishings appear on screen has been temporarily disabled while the team investigates furnishing display issues.
- In residential areas, your own outdoor furnishings now display with priority if many outside furnishings are nearby.
- The patch adds new furnishings and orchestrion rolls, giving housing players a few new items to check.
- To reduce congestion after the patch release, multiple field instances have been implemented for Auxesia and Tuliyollal.
- Solution Nine, Garlemald, Mare Lamentorum, Yak T’el, and Oizys are no longer separated into multiple instances.
